+``-smbios type=41[,designation=str][,kind=str][,instance=%d][,pcidev=str]``
+ Specify SMBIOS type 41 fields
+
+ This argument can be repeated multiple times. Its main use is to allow network interfaces be created
+ as ``enoX`` on Linux, with X being the instance number, instead of the name depending on the interface
+ position on the PCI bus.
+
+ Here is an example of use:
+
+ .. parsed-literal::
+
+ -netdev user,id=internet \\
+ -device virtio-net-pci,mac=50:54:00:00:00:42,netdev=internet,id=internet-dev \\
+ -smbios type=41,designation='Onboard LAN',instance=1,kind=ethernet,pcidev=internet-dev
+
+ In the guest OS, the device should then appear as ``eno1``:
+
+ ..parsed-literal::
+
+ $ ip -brief l
+ lo UNKNOWN 00:00:00:00:00:00 <LOOPBACK,UP,LOWER_UP>
+ eno1 UP 50:54:00:00:00:42 <BROADCAST,MULTICAST,UP,LOWER_UP>
+
+ Currently, the PCI device has to be attached to the root bus.
